10 Memorable Unplugged Performances

Foto

Shakira - Ciega Sordomuda

Shakira's Unplugged has lots of highlights, and many of you may argue that 'Ojos Asi' was the best track but this mariachi fest during “Ciega Sordo Muda” it's a killer. Los Mora Arriaga take this song to a whole new level. Don't believe us? Check it out!

 

 Foto

 

La Ley - El Duelo

 

This song was already a weeper but when Beto Cuevas decided to invite Mexican songstress Ely Guerra on-stage for this special performance of 'El Duelo' he made it worse aka spectacular. Ely's sweet voice along with Beto's it's a perfect match. We never want to hear this song sans Ely, again! Hmmm, lentamente!!!

Nirvana - Pennyroyal Tea

 

We were torn between this and "The Man Who Sold the World" a Davie Bowie cover better than the original (and DB it's hard to top). But, seeing Kurt Cobain strum that acoustic guitar all by his lonesome tops anything else, ever! We miss you Kurt.

 

Foto

 

Alejandro Sanz - Aprendiz

Sanz debuted this song in his Unplugged, and it’s a huge tearjerker! We almost want to look away from this sort of pain but can’t. It’s too good!

 

 

Foto

Bjork - Like Someone In Love

The pint-sized Icelandic queen just stands on stage and sings this little number with just a harp to keep her company, all in a little yellow neon dress. Too adorable for words!

 

 

Foto

 

Cafe Tacuba - El Baile y El Salón

We love this stripped down version of a Cafeta classic. Check out the hairstyles, you got the '90s to thank for that! Paparupapa euuu euuu...

 

Foto

 

 

Soda Stereo – En La Ciudad de la Furia

This WHOLE unplugged album is beyond great but this particular tune with Aterciopelados front lady Andrea Echeverri takes the memorable prize, check out Andrea’s outfit! She’d definitely make US Weekly’s worst dressed list but we can’t help but love her. And, hmmm, Cerati!

Foto

 

Aterciopelados – Expreso Amazonia 

Llame ya!! Llame Ahora!! We got Andrea-fever. This is a great live song at every Aterciopelados concert so why not relive it in this list? And again, the fashion! We’re almost feeling like dusting off our boa and twirling around in circles.

 

Foto

Ricky Martin – Tu Recuerdo

Even though we’re not immune to Ricky’s hip gyration magic, we were really happy to see him toning it down. The duet with La Mari from chill out flamenco band Chambao, makes this song even better. Julieta Venegas – De Mis Pasos

Let’s conclude that when great artists invite other great musicians on-stage, an instant memorable moment is born. Here, Julieta shares the song with Juan Son from the Mexican indie band Porter and we get the retro sound we were missing from her for a while! Go, go edgy Julieta!
